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
804 290877 4124306874 71
215 593973 3029893318
215 593973 3029893318
642235234 44 7222788044 3381926118 108
All about undefined
Interested in learning more?
215 593973 3029893318
642235234 44 7222788044 3381926118 108
See more
61907689383 71655020
549 016 510369 53786
See more
78 93 273
90083863162 3061 553287
See more